Youth level.
"An ALA Notable Book; A School Library Journal Best Book of the Year; A Book Sense 76 Selection"--P. 4 Cover.
In Depression-era Philadelphia, when eleven-year-old David is too ill to attend school, he is tutored by the unique and adventurous Aunt Annie, whose teaching combines with his imagination to greatly enrich his life.
